#6935c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6935c4 is composed of 41.2% red, 20.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 73%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 261.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 48.8%. #6935c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d26aff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6935c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6935c4 has RGB values of R:105, G:53,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 6895044.

Shades and Tints of #6935c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06030b is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6935c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7881 is the less saturated color, while #5c05f4 is the most saturated one.
